Transaction 595bcda479840fcc9436dd4e2c8bd837df4580f5d5636be4e19609286948d611
1 Input
1 Output
-
595bcda479840fcc9436dd4e2c8bd837df4580f5d5636be4e19609286948d611:0
- value
- 1670360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17dc0730a1b1589a55b60adb8f973307771233b8 OP_EQUAL
- address
- 33sB3mvFwT1xijsXyMgXZdLxY6PHya9Jub